Arecanut (Areca catechu L.) Seed Polyphenol-Ameliorated Osteoporosis by Altering Gut Microbiome via LYZ and the Immune System in Estrogen-Deficient Rats

Fengfeng Mei et al.

Summary: This study showed that ACP could improve osteoporosis by regulating the gut microbiota, enhancing trabecular microstructure, and decreasing the microbial population with negative effects on bone metabolism, thus controlling the inflammatory reaction.

JOURNAL OF AGRICULTURAL AND FOOD CHEMISTRY (2021)

Tilapia head glycolipids protect mice against dextran sulfate sodium-induced colitis by ameliorating the gut barrier and suppressing NF-kappa B signaling pathway

Zhipeng Gu et al.

Summary: The study evaluated the relieving effect of tilapia head glycolipids (TH-GLs) on DSS-induced colitis in mice and explored its potential mechanism. TH-GLs significantly improved colon lesions, increased mucus secretion, extended colon length, and inhibited inflammatory cytokines. These findings suggest that TH-GLs could potentially be used in treating colitis by improving gut barrier function and suppressing inflammation.

INTERNATIONAL IMMUNOPHARMACOLOGY (2021)
